Film Overview and Key Details

The movie "Wildcats" first came out in 1986, and it quickly became a film many people enjoyed. It’s a sports comedy, which means it has lots of funny moments and some exciting football action. Michael Ritchie was the one who directed it, and he did a good job of bringing the story to life. The movie is pretty well-known for its main star, Goldie Hawn, who plays a really unique character. Here are some quick facts about the "Wildcats" movie:

TitleWildcats
Release Year1986
GenreSports Comedy
DirectorMichael Ritchie
Main StarGoldie Hawn
Notable DebutsWesley Snipes, Woody Harrelson, LL Cool J

The Story of Molly McGrath and Her Wildcats

The whole story of "Wildcats" centers around Molly McGrath, played by Goldie Hawn. She’s a college track coach, but she has a big dream: she wants to coach high school football. So, she takes a job at a rather rundown school, and it turns out to be a lot tougher than she thought it would be. This is where the comedy really kicks in, because her new team, the Wildcats, are a bit of a mess, to be honest. They need a lot of guidance, and Molly is just the person to give it to them.

Molly has to deal with a lot of challenges. She’s a woman coaching a boys’ football team, which was pretty unusual for the time, and some people don’t take her seriously at all. She also has to manage her own family life, which adds another layer to her character. But, you know, she’s incredibly determined, and she won’t give up on these kids. She pushes them to believe in themselves and to work together as a team, which is a pretty powerful message for a movie like this.

Her approach is often unconventional, and that’s where a lot of the laughs come from. She’s not afraid to be tough, but she also truly cares about the players. The film shows her struggles and her triumphs as she tries to turn this group of underdogs into a team that can actually win. A Look at the Amazing Cast and Their Early Roles

One of the truly cool things about "Wildcats" is seeing some really famous actors in their very first movie roles. For example, Wesley Snipes, who later became a huge action star, made his screen debut in this film. He’s got a lot of energy, even back then. Then there’s Woody Harrelson, another actor who went on to have a fantastic career, and he also got his start here. It’s fascinating to watch them and see how much talent they had right from the beginning, honestly.

The film also features LL Cool J, who many know as a famous musician, but he shows off his acting skills here too. And, of course, Goldie Hawn is just brilliant as Molly McGrath. She brings so much warmth and humor to the role, which is something she’s always been good at. She plays a college football coach in a rundown school, which is a unique twist for her. There are other familiar faces too, like Swoosie Kurtz, who adds a lot to the movie with her performance, and Robyn Lively, who also appears.

There are, in fact, seven different kinds of wild cats that live in North America. These include animals like the bobcat, the Canada lynx, and the puma, which some people also call a mountain lion or cougar. Then there are others like the margay, ocelot, jaguarundi, and the jaguar. These animals are mostly active at night and tend to be solitary. What is the movie Wildcats about Goldie Hawn?

The movie "Wildcats" is about Molly McGrath, played by Goldie Hawn. She’s a college track coach who really wants to coach high school football. She takes on a challenging job at a tough, rundown school, leading a boys' football team called the Wildcats. The film shows her struggles and triumphs as she tries to turn this underdog team into winners, all while dealing with personal and professional obstacles. It’s a sports comedy that’s pretty funny and also very heartwarming, to be honest.

Who played in the Wildcats movie 1986?

The 1986 "Wildcats" movie features a great cast. Goldie Hawn stars as Molly McGrath. Other key actors include James Keach and Swoosie Kurtz. It’s also very notable for being the film debut for several actors who would become hugely famous: Wesley Snipes, Woody Harrelson, and LL Cool J. You can also spot Robyn Lively and Brandy Gold in the film. It’s quite a collection of talent, which is something that really stands out about the movie.
